Lifetime Unveils 17 New Designers for Project Runway, Season Eight
In the show's expanded 90-minute format, the new crop of designers will encounter host Heidi Klum, mentor Tim Gunn and judges Michael Kors
and Nina Garcia and top-name guest designer and celebrity judges, including actress Selma Blair for the premiere episode, as they face
inventive challenges, unexpected eliminations and other surprises along the way. Filmed on location in New York, each episode of the eighth
season will feature more couture creations and fashion flubs as the designers attempt to make the cut to show at New York Fashion Week at
Lincoln Center. Project Runway is in High-Definition where available.

As part of the winner's prize package, this season's victorious designer will receive $100,000 from L'Oreal Paris to start his/her own line, a
fashion spread in Marie Claire magazine, a $50,000 technology suite by HP and Intel to create his/her own vision and run his/her business and
the opportunity to design and sell an exclusive collection on Piperlime.com. The model paired with the winner of Project Runway will also appear
in the designer's editorial feature in Marie Claire and receive $25,000 from L'Oreal Studio Secrets Professional.
